Europe Critical Care Equipment Market Size
- The Europe critical care equipment market size was valued at USD 10.97 billion in 2024 and is expected to reach USD 20.32 billion by 2032, at a CAGR of 8.0% during the forecast period
- The market growth is largely fueled by the rising prevalence of chronic diseases, an aging population requiring intensive care, and growing demand for advanced monitoring and life-support technologies across healthcare facilities in Europe
- Furthermore, increasing healthcare expenditure, technological advancements in ventilators, patient monitoring systems, and infusion pumps, along with heightened emphasis on preparedness for emergencies and pandemics, are accelerating the adoption of critical care equipment, thereby significantly boosting the region’s market growth

Europe Critical Care Equipment Market Trends
Integration of AI and Remote Patient Monitoring in ICUs
- A significant and accelerating trend in the Europe critical care equipment market is the integration of artificial intelligence (AI), tele-ICU platforms, and remote patient monitoring systems into critical care settings. This fusion of technologies is enhancing decision-making, optimizing ICU workflows, and enabling proactive patient management
- For instance, Philips introduced AI-enabled monitoring systems that provide predictive analytics for early detection of patient deterioration, helping healthcare professionals make timely interventions. Similarly, Dräger offers advanced ventilators with integrated decision-support features
- AI integration in patient monitoring devices enables continuous analysis of vital signs and can trigger predictive alerts, reducing adverse events and improving clinical outcomes. Remote monitoring solutions also allow intensivists to manage multiple ICUs across different hospital sites, addressing workforce shortages in Europe
- The seamless integration of critical care devices with hospital information systems (HIS) and electronic health records (EHR) allows for centralized patient data management, improving clinical workflows and supporting precision medicine
- This trend toward smarter, connected, and data-driven intensive care units is fundamentally reshaping expectations in European healthcare systems. Consequently, companies such as Siemens Healthineers and GE Healthcare are developing AI-driven monitoring and imaging systems, enabling real-time, evidence-based care in critical care environments
- The demand for AI-enabled and interoperable critical care devices is rapidly expanding across Europe, particularly in advanced hospital settings, as providers prioritize patient safety, efficiency, and improved outcomes in intensive care units
Europe Critical Care Equipment Market Dynamics
Driver
Rising ICU Admissions Due to Aging Population and Chronic Diseases
- The increasing burden of chronic conditions such as cardiovascular diseases, respiratory disorders, and sepsis, coupled with Europe’s aging population, is a major driver for critical care equipment demand
- For instance, Eurostat reported that over 21% of the EU’s population was aged 65 or above in 2024, significantly raising ICU admission rates. This demographic shift is pushing hospitals to upgrade and expand their critical care infrastructure
- Patient monitoring devices and ventilators are becoming essential for managing the growing number of elderly patients with multi-organ complications, leading to strong adoption across European hospitals
- Furthermore, government healthcare investments and policies aimed at strengthening ICU capacity and preparedness for health crises (such as pandemics) are fueling the market
- The dominance of Patient Monitoring Devices with a market share of 36.5% in 2024 reflects the region’s need for continuous monitoring solutions that can detect complications early and support clinical decision-making in high-risk patients
Restraint/Challenge
High Equipment Costs and Stringent Regulatory Hurdles
- The high cost of advanced critical care equipment, including AI-enabled monitoring systems and next-generation ventilators, presents a significant barrier to adoption, particularly for smaller hospitals and specialty clinics across Europe
- For instance, premium devices with predictive analytics or remote connectivity features often require substantial upfront investments, making procurement difficult under constrained healthcare budgets
- In addition, strict regulatory frameworks in Europe, such as the EU Medical Device Regulation (MDR), increase compliance costs and lengthen approval timelines for new devices, slowing down innovation and product launches
- Cybersecurity concerns associated with connected devices also remain a challenge, as data breaches or system vulnerabilities in hospital networks can compromise patient safety and data integrity
- Overcoming these hurdles through cost-effective solutions, regulatory harmonization, and stronger cybersecurity protocols will be essential for driving broader adoption across both developed and mid-sized healthcare facilities in Europe
Europe Critical Care Equipment Market Scope
The market is segmented on the basis of product type, patient population, end user, and distribution channel.
- By Product Type
On the basis of product type, the Europe critical care equipment market is segmented into therapeutic devices, patient monitoring devices, diagnostic devices, ICU units & system, and other devices. The patient monitoring devices segment dominated the market with the largest revenue share of 37% in 2024, driven by the rising need for continuous vital sign monitoring in ICUs and the growing adoption of AI-integrated monitoring systems for early detection of complications. The increasing prevalence of chronic diseases and sepsis cases across Europe has further reinforced the demand for advanced monitoring solutions.
The therapeutic devices segment is anticipated to witness the fastest growth rate of 7.9% CAGR from 2025 to 2032, fueled by advancements in ventilators, infusion pumps, and dialysis machines. The post-pandemic demand for sophisticated respiratory support systems and the expansion of ICU capacity across hospitals in Europe are driving rapid growth in this segment. Technological improvements, such as portable ventilators and AI-enabled infusion pumps, are enhancing patient outcomes and operational efficiency.
- By Patient Population
On the basis of patient population, the Europe critical care equipment market is segmented into neonatal, pediatric, adults, and geriatric. The adult segment dominated the market with the largest revenue share of 48.7% in 2024, as adults represent the majority of ICU admissions due to higher incidences of trauma, cardiac events, and lifestyle-related chronic diseases. Hospitals across Europe are investing heavily in monitoring and therapeutic solutions to meet the growing demand for adult critical care.
The geriatric segment is expected to grow at the fastest CAGR of 8.2% from 2025 to 2032, as Europe faces a rapidly aging population, leading to a surge in ICU admissions for age-related conditions such as respiratory insufficiency, multi-organ failure, and cardiovascular complications. The geriatric segment is increasingly benefitting from AI-integrated monitoring solutions and minimally invasive therapeutic devices, allowing clinicians to provide safer, more personalized care.
- By End User
On the basis of end user, the Europe critical care equipment market is segmented into hospitals, specialty clinics, ambulatory surgical centers, and others. The hospitals segment dominated the market with the largest revenue share of 62.4% in 2024, as hospitals account for the majority of ICU beds and receive substantial funding for advanced critical care infrastructure. Their capacity to adopt cutting-edge technologies such as AI-enabled monitoring devices and advanced ventilators also strengthens their leadership position.
The ambulatory surgical centers (ASCs) segment is projected to register the fastest growth at a CAGR of 7.4% from 2025 to 2032, supported by the rising number of day-care surgeries, cost-effectiveness of treatment in ASCs, and increasing adoption of compact and portable monitoring and therapeutic equipment. ASCs are also leveraging digital and remote monitoring technologies to manage post-operative patients effectively.
- By Distribution Channel
On the basis of distribution channel, the Europe critical care equipment market is segmented into direct tenders, retail sales, third-party distribution, and others. The direct tenders segment dominated the market with the largest revenue share of 54.2% in 2024, as bulk procurement by government healthcare systems and large hospital networks ensures cost efficiency, timely supply, and standardization of equipment. Direct tenders are particularly strong in Western Europe where public healthcare systems dominate procurement.
The retail sales segment is expected to expand at the fastest CAGR of 6.8% from 2025 to 2032, driven by the increasing adoption of portable monitoring devices and point-of-care equipment in smaller clinics and homecare settings, coupled with growing e-commerce and distributor networks across Europe. E-commerce platforms and healthcare distributors are increasing accessibility, enabling smaller clinics and even homecare setups to adopt advanced critical care solutions.

What are the Recent Developments in Europe Critical Care Equipment Market?
- In August 2025, Getinge regained the EU CE Mark for its Cardiosave Intra-Aortic Balloon Pump (IABP) following a period of suspension. The device’s reaffirmed certification reflects successful implementation of required design improvements, enabling Getinge to resume deliveries to CE-mark-accepting European markets starting in Q4 2025. This reinstatement ensures continued access to this vital cardiovascular support tool in critical care
- In April 2025, CBM Lifemotion launched its Lifemotion System, a next-generation extracorporeal life support (ECLS) device, in Europe following CE-marking. The first clinical cases were performed in Germany and Spain, marking its initial use outside China
- In April 2024, Asahi Kasei Medical (in collaboration with AW Technologies) highlighted the TrachFlush, a medical device designed to reduce discomfort during tracheal suctioning while easing caregiver workload. The device, already CE-marked in Europe since 2020, applies a unique cuff pressure control system to better manage airway secretions
- In November 2023, Resvent Medical showcased its latest respiratory care innovations at MEDICA 2023 in Düsseldorf. Featured products included the EIT-iNueview (thoracic electrical impedance tomography), a high-flow non-invasive respiratory humidification therapy device, iBreeze III (third-generation home ventilator), and iApneaMate (sleep apnea monitor)
- In May 2021, CorVent Medical received CE Mark approval for its RESPOND-19™ Ventilator, enabling its commercial launch across Europe. This cost-effective device provides both invasive and non-invasive respiratory support, offering hospitals a flexible and reliable solution to expand critical care ventilation capabilities
